Explore the mangrove forests

It’s famous for its dense mangrove forests, Sundarbans is a UNESCO World Heritage Site. A houseboat trip through the winding waterways is a must. As you cruise through the calm waters, you will witness the rich biodiversity of the region. Keep an eye out for the majestic Royal Bengal Tiger, although sightings are rare, the thrill of being in their territory is like no other. The mangrove forest in Sundarban is the biggest mangrove forest in Asia. So, you should enjoy the natural beauty of Sundarban.

Wildlife safari

Apart from tigers, the Sundarban is home to a variety of wildlife, including spotted deer, salted crocodiles, and many species of birds. A guided safari will take you into the jungle, giving you the chance to see these animals in their natural habitat. October to mid-April is an ideal time for such a trip, as the weather is pleasant and wildlife sightings are more likely.

Enjoy Bird Watching

Sundarban is a paradise for bird enthusiasts. The area is home to many migratory and resident bird species. Grab your binoculars and head to the bird-watching spot in the morning to catch a glimpse of these nurturing beauties.
